Godmama

An interesting concept, Godmama is a Peranakan restaurant with a modern twist. Designed to celebrate family heirloom recipes while bringing an essential modern twist, look forward to delights such as bhah keluak bolognese pasta as well as such interesting  Peranakan-inspired cocktails. 

109 North Bridge Rd, FUNAN, #04-07

 

Kausmo

In their own words, Kausmo from Les  Amis Group: Derived from the word “Cosmos” – a system of thought, Kausmo is a concept that promotes thoughtful living by challenging food norms that bring about unnecessary food wastage. 

Part dining experience, part life experience, Kausmo is the brain child of co-founders Lisa Tang and Kuah Chew Shian who want diners to leave making more thoughtful choices when it comes to dining and their everyday lives. How do they seek to achieve this? Well, the brave co-founders have created a menu and concept that creatively repurposes aesthetically filtered items  that might have been overlooked before, along with taking on a sustainable approach by using local suppliers and secondary cuts of meat. 

1 Scotts Rd, #03-07, Shaw Centre

 

La Dame de Pic

Fine dining establishments in Singapore are quaking in their boots now that renowned French  chef, Anne-Sophie Pic  has made her debut at Raffles Hotel. With two other restaurants in Paris and London, thanks to her superb use of local ingredients and a refined and  thoughtful menu, this is one of the most interesting and luxurious restaurants to hit our shores in quite some time.  

1 Beach Rd, Raffles Hotel Singapore
